Trendy and elegant puff pastry tarts baked upside down to caramelize toppings like honey, cheese, and fresh fruit. A perfect crispy treat.

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a large baking sheet with high-quality parchment paper.
đĄ Tip: Do not skip parchment paper, or the honey will stick to the pan.
Drizzle six small dollops of honey (about 1/2 tablespoon each) onto the parchment paper, spacing them evenly apart.
đĄ Tip: Spread the honey slightly with the back of a spoon to match the size of your pastry rectangles.
Arrange 2 to 3 thin apple slices directly on top of each honey dollop, then place a piece of brie cheese over the apples.
đĄ Tip: Keep the toppings compact so the pastry can completely cover them.
Place one rectangle of puff pastry directly over each pile of toppings. Use a fork to press and seal the edges of the pastry down onto the parchment paper.
đĄ Tip: This traps the steam and helps caramelize the ingredients underneath.
Brush the top of each puff pastry piece lightly with the beaten egg wash, then poke a few holes in the center with a fork.
đĄ Tip: Poking holes prevents the pastry from puffing up too unevenly.
Bake in the preheated oven for 15 to 18 minutes, or until the pastry is deeply golden brown and puffed.
đĄ Tip: Watch closely during the last few minutes to ensure the honey doesn't burn.
Remove from the oven and allow to cool for 2 to 3 minutes. Carefully flip each pastry over using a spatula to reveal the caramelized top.
đĄ Tip: Flip them while warm; if they cool completely, the honey will harden and stick to the paper.
Garnish with fresh rosemary leaves and an extra drizzle of warm honey before serving. Best enjoyed warm on the day they are made.
